Meeting Details

The approval was sought solely through a postal ballot conducted via remote e-voting; there was no physical meeting. The voting period commenced on Wednesday, August 19, 2026, at 09:00 a.m. IST and concluded on Thursday, September 17, 2026, at 05:00 p.m. IST. The results are deemed to have been passed on the last date of e-voting, i.e., September 17, 2026. The record date for determining shareholder eligibility was Friday, August 14, 2026.

Proposed Resolutions and Implications

Two special resolutions were proposed for shareholder approval:

1. Resolution No. 01: To ratify the ESOP Scheme titled "Kusumgar ESOP 2024".

2. Resolution No. 02: To approve the grant of stock options to the employees of the Group companies, including the Holding Company, Subsidiary companies, and Associate companies, in India or outside India, under the "Kusumgar ESOP 2024".

The promoters/promoter group were not interested in these resolutions.

Voting Process and Methods

The voting was conducted entirely through remote e-voting. National Securities Depository Limited (NSDL) was appointed to provide the e-voting facility. The process was advertised in "Business Standard" (English) and "Navshakti" (Marathi) on Wednesday, August 19, 2026. The company sent the notice and explanatory statement via email to all members whose details were registered as of the record date.

Key Voting Outcomes

Overall Participation

  • Total number of shareholders on the record date: 34,377
  • Total number of shares outstanding: 10,49,91,372
  • Total votes polled: 9,04,56,499 shares (86.1561% of outstanding shares)

Resolution No. 01: Ratify ESOP Scheme

  • Grand Total Votes: 9,04,56,499
  • Votes in Favour: 8,11,63,170 (89.7262% of votes polled)
  • Votes Against: 92,93,329 (10.2738% of votes polled)
  • Category-wise Breakdown:
  • Promoter & Promoter Group: Held 7,87,54,401 shares; voted 7,87,43,829 shares (99.9866% participation); 100% in favour.
  • Public Institutions: Held 1,56,21,106 shares; voted 1,06,51,277 shares (68.1852% participation); 12.8132% in favour, 87.1868% against.
  • Public Non-Institutions: Held 1,06,15,865 shares; voted 10,61,393 shares (9.9982% participation); 99.3576% in favour, 0.6424% against.

Resolution No. 02: Approve Grant of Stock Options

  • Grand Total Votes: 9,04,56,499
  • Votes in Favour: 8,11,63,045 (89.7261% of votes polled)
  • Votes Against: 92,93,454 (10.2739% of votes polled)
  • Category-wise Breakdown:
  • Promoter & Promoter Group: Voted 7,87,43,829 shares; 100% in favour.
  • Public Institutions: Voted 1,06,51,277 shares; 12.8132% in favour, 87.1868% against.
  • Public Non-Institutions: Voted 10,61,393 shares; 99.3459% in favour, 0.6541% against.

Scrutinizer's Role and Findings

Vaibhav Dandawate (ACS 51538, CP 27947), a Partner at Makarand M. Joshi & Co., was appointed as the Scrutinizer. His role was to scrutinize all votes cast through the remote e-voting process. He confirmed the following:

  • The electronic register of votes was properly maintained.
  • There were no shares with differential voting rights.
  • There were no invalid votes cast on any resolution.
  • Votes cast do not include abstained votes.
  • The Foreign Portfolio Investor (FPI) voting restriction clause was not applicable.
  • He concluded that both resolutions were passed by the requisite majority of the members.

Compliance Confirmation

The disclosure confirms that the entire process was conducted in compliance with:

  • Sections 108 and 110 of the Companies Act, 2013.
  • Rules 20 and 22 of the Companies (Management and Administration) Rules, 2014.
  • SEBI (Listing Obligations and Disclosure Requirements) Regulations, 2015, specifically Regulation 44.
  • MCA General Circular No. 03/2025 dated September 22, 2025.
  • The Secretarial Standard – 2 on General Meetings.
